Physical Information

Selenite is a transparent to milky-white variety of the mineral gypsum, composed of calcium sulfate.
It forms in long, fibrous, and often striated crystal structures, giving it a silky, glowing appearance that seems to radiate inner light.
Selenite can grow into large, clear blades, satin-like wands, or desert rose formations depending on environment.
Because it is relatively soft (Mohs hardness 2), it can be scratched easily and should be kept dry, as water can dissolve or damage its surface.
Major sources include Mexico, Morocco, Greece, Australia, and the USA.
